Blount County, TN vs Cobb County, GA
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
Blount County, TN: 0.58% effective rate · $1,502/yr median tax · median home $259,116
Cobb County, GA: 0.74% effective rate · $2,466/yr median tax · median home $333,244
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| Blount County, TN | Cobb County, GA |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Effective Tax Rate | 0.58% | 0.74% | 1.06% |
| Median Annual Tax | $1,502 | $2,466 | $2,778 |
| Median Home Value | $259,116 | $333,244 | $268,728 |
| Population | 133,088 | 766,149 | — |
